Arsenal is close to tickets to the Champions League

BrotherThe 2-1 victory over Leeds in round 36 helped coach Mikel Arteta’s team firmly build fourth place in the Premier League.

This result helps Arsenal reach 66 points in 35 matches, five points ahead of Tottenham. On May 12, the two teams will face off directly at Tottenham in the match for round 22 of the Premier League. If they win, Arsenal will definitely finish in the top 4, and return to the Champions League for the first time since the 2017-2018 season under the legendary manager Arsene Wenger.

Meanwhile, Leeds dropped to 18th because in the same match, Everton won 2-1 at Leicester. Leeds currently has 34 points, equal to Burnley and one point behind Everton.

At the Emirates Stadium, coach Arteta has only one change compared to the 2-1 win at West Ham on May 1. Takehiro Tomiyasu replaced Nuno Tavares and was pushed to the left-back, while Cedric Soares played on the opposite flank.

Arsenal got off to a dream start when they opened the scoring after 5 minutes. Goalkeeper Illan Meslier was too slow in the penalty area, allowing Eddie Nketiah to kick into an empty net. Five minutes later, the 22-year-old England striker completed a brace with a diagonal kick from Gabriel Martinelli’s cross. Nketiah thus became the second Arsenal player to score twice in the first ten minutes of a Premier League match, after Nwankwo Kanu against Sunderland in October 2002.

In the 27th minute, Arsenal were even better than people, when Luke Ayling received a red card directly after a two-footed challenge to Martinelli. Initially, referee Chris Kavanagh only showed a yellow card to the Leeds right-back, but changed his mind after consulting VAR.

The “Gunners” thus completely controlled the game and created countless opportunities. In the 39th minute, Meslier caught the ball from Martin Odegaard’s free kick, but defender Diego Llorente cleared the ball just before the rush line. From the 55th to the 60th minute, Martinelli had two consecutive shots in the penalty area, but the ball was blocked by Meslier in turn and went wide over the visitors’ goal.

But then, the game suddenly turned around. In the 66th minute, from a corner kick, Junior Firpo headed back to the far corner to let Llorente – in an unaccompanied position – finish close to the wall to shorten the gap for Leeds. This is Leeds’ first shot in this match, and the second time Arsenal have conceded a goal from a corner in the Premier League 2021-2022 season..

Arteta worried, and took turns tossing Nicolas Pepe, Emile Smith-Rowe and Alexandre Lacazette. Arsenal still dominated the ball, but were deadlocked and could not create delicious opportunities. Not only that, the host also experienced the last minutes of heart-pounding, when goalkeeper Meslier joined the attack in two fixed Leeds situations, before celebrating three points when the referee blew the final whistle.
